Food, Wine Served Up at Taste of Willow Grove Today

Over 20 restaurants will show off samples of their finest offerings.

The annual festive tribute to the area's culinary delights unfolds at the Taste of Willow Grove on December 2, 2012. In addition, Blue Mountain Winery will provide wine tasting and a student from Eastern Tech will again tempt visitors with their popular crab cakes. The festivities will take place at Kremp's Florists, York and Davisville Roads, from 5 p.m. to 8 p.m.

The event is designed to allow neighbors to intermingle with business people and local dignitaries. It will feature appetizers, entrees and desserts. In addition, complimentary beer, wine and soft drinks will be available. There will also be raffles and fun activities to highlight the community in a cheerful holiday atmosphere.

Tickets available from the chamber are only $20 in advance or $25 at the door. All members of the community are welcome. This is a non-smoking, adults only event. Dress is business casual.
